Javascript Typescript不使用JS函数(Typeof)

Javascript Typescript不使用JS函数(Typeof),javascript,angular,typescript,Javascript,Angular,Typescript,我试图在Angular typescript中执行一个JS代码,这不是我的代码,情况是Angular之外的代码工作得很好,一旦在编译器内部,我会遇到很多错误,其中我无法解决这个问题: 我不知道为什么它不能捕获、定义或全局,typescript应该是JS的扩展,所有JS代码都应该工作 航站楼给了我那个错误: 但是@types已经安装好了,我在tsconfig.json上看到了: TypeScript不知道这些东西是什么。您需要为编译器声明它们。将其添加到函数上方,这样编译器就不会再抱怨了。如果

我试图在Angular typescript中执行一个JS代码,这不是我的代码,情况是Angular之外的代码工作得很好,一旦在编译器内部,我会遇到很多错误,其中我无法解决这个问题:

我不知道为什么它不能捕获、定义或全局,typescript应该是JS的扩展,所有JS代码都应该工作

航站楼给了我那个错误:

但是@types已经安装好了,我在tsconfig.json上看到了:


TypeScript不知道这些东西是什么。您需要为编译器声明它们。将其添加到函数上方,这样编译器就不会再抱怨了。如果需要,您可以添加打字,而不是
any

declare define: any;
declare global: any; 

typeof
当然可以在Typescript中找到。但它对变量
define
global
一无所知。它们是如何定义的,在哪里定义的?请将它们发布到问题中好吗?请提供最小的可复制存储库,其中至少包含您的
tsconfig.json
package.json
和有问题的屏幕截图项目文件。所提供的信息对回答问题没有帮助。被接受的问题会起作用,但这否认了为什么你会首先使用打字脚本的目的。。。
declare define: any;
declare global: any;